class ComputeResourcesController < ApplicationController
include Foreman::Controller::AutoCompleteSearch
AJAX_REQUESTS = %w{template_selected cluster_selected}
before_filter :ajax_request, :only => AJAX_REQUESTS
before_filter :find_by_name, :only => [:show, :edit, :associate, :update, :destroy, :ping] + AJAX_REQUESTS

def index
@compute_resources = resource_base.search_for(params[:search], :order => params[:order]).paginate :page => params[:page]
end

def new
@compute_resource = ComputeResource.new
end

def show
end

def create
if params[:compute_resource].present? && params[:compute_resource][:provider].present?
@compute_resource = ComputeResource.new_provider params[:compute_resource]
if @compute_resource.save
# Add the new compute resource to the user's filters
@compute_resource.users << User.current
process_success :success_redirect => @compute_resource
else
process_error
end
else
@compute_resource = ComputeResource.new params[:compute_resource]
@compute_resource.valid?
process_error
end
end

def edit
end

def associate
count = 0
if @compute_resource.respond_to?(:associated_host)
@compute_resource.vms(:eager_loading => true).each do |vm|
if Host.where(:uuid => vm.identity).empty?
host = @compute_resource.associated_host(vm)
if host.present?
host.uuid = vm.identity
host.compute_resource_id = @compute_resource.id
host.save!(:validate => false) # don't want to trigger callbacks
count += 1
end
end
end
end
process_success(:success_msg => n_("%s VM associated to a host", "%s VMs associated to hosts", count) % count)
end

def update
params[:compute_resource].except!(:password) if params[:compute_resource][:password].blank?
if @compute_resource.update_attributes(params[:compute_resource])
process_success
else
process_error
end
end

def destroy
if @compute_resource.destroy
process_success
else
process_error
end
end

#ajax methods
def provider_selected
@compute_resource = ComputeResource.new_provider :provider => params[:provider]
render :partial => "compute_resources/form", :locals => { :compute_resource => @compute_resource }
end

def ping
respond_to do |format|
format.json {render :json => errors_hash(@compute_resource.ping)}
end
end

def test_connection
# cr_id is posted from AJAX function. cr_id is nil if new
Rails.logger.info "CR_ID IS #{params[:cr_id]}"
if params[:cr_id].present? && params[:cr_id] != 'null'
@compute_resource = ComputeResource.authorized(:edit_compute_resources).find(params[:cr_id])
params[:compute_resource].delete(:password) if params[:compute_resource][:password].blank?
@compute_resource.attributes = params[:compute_resource]
else
@compute_resource = ComputeResource.new_provider(params[:compute_resource])
end
@compute_resource.test_connection :force => true
render :partial => "compute_resources/form", :locals => { :compute_resource => @compute_resource }
end

def template_selected
compute = @compute_resource.template(params[:template_id])
respond_to do |format|
format.json { render :json => compute }
end
end

def cluster_selected
networks = @compute_resource.networks(:cluster_id => params[:cluster_id])
respond_to do |format|
format.json { render :json => networks }
end
end

private

def action_permission
case params[:action]
when 'associate'
'edit'
when 'ping', 'template_selected', 'cluster_selected'
'view'
else
super
end
end
end
